Output 0845668049f2db9a0ce34808fc3166d30c6f7bf45e6f087033f421fb35e396e7:0

value
8579653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ec75e7dd5e74ad20bd77ff134b57afea31d3271 OP_EQUAL
address
3EhxiC6YFjWgQ5yNZsNsMQySDFEmLCwXDj
transaction
0845668049f2db9a0ce34808fc3166d30c6f7bf45e6f087033f421fb35e396e7
spent
true